Why AI matters at this scale

Washington and Lee University (W&L) is a prestigious private liberal arts university in Lexington, Virginia, founded in 1749. With an enrollment that places it in the 501-1000 employee size band, W&L is dedicated to providing a highly personalized, rigorous undergraduate education in the arts, sciences, and law, grounded in a honor system and close student-faculty interaction.

For a mid-sized institution like W&L, AI is not about industrial-scale transformation but about targeted augmentation. It offers tools to deepen its commitment to personalized education in an era of tightening budgets and increased competition for students. At this scale, the university is agile enough to pilot innovative solutions but must be strategic, focusing on high-impact areas that align with its core values without overextending limited IT resources. AI can help W&L maintain its competitive edge and distinctive educational model through data-informed decision-making and enhanced student support.

Concrete AI Opportunities with ROI Framing

1. Predictive Analytics for Student Retention: Implementing an AI system that synthesizes data from learning management systems, campus engagement, and early academic performance can identify students at risk of attrition long before traditional methods. The ROI is direct: retaining just a few additional students per year preserves significant tuition revenue and improves graduation rates, a key metric for rankings and alumni satisfaction. The cost of a SaaS predictive analytics platform is far outweighed by the financial and reputational benefits of improved student success.

2. AI-Augmented Academic Advising: An AI tool could analyze a student's academic history, interests, and trajectory to suggest optimal course selections, research opportunities, and career pathways. This empowers advisors with insights, making their guidance more proactive and comprehensive. The ROI manifests in higher student satisfaction, better on-time graduation rates, and more efficient use of advising resources. It turns data into a strategic asset for fulfilling the university's mentorship promise.

3. Intelligent Enrollment Management: Machine learning models can optimize financial aid packaging and predict yield from admitted students with greater accuracy. By analyzing historical data and broader market trends, W&L can allocate its aid budget more strategically to build an optimal incoming class. The ROI is a stronger, more diverse student body and maximized net tuition revenue per cohort, directly supporting the institution's financial sustainability.

Deployment Risks Specific to This Size Band

For a university of W&L's size, deployment risks are pronounced. Resource Constraints mean a failed AI project can have a disproportionate impact on budgets and staff morale, necessitating a start-small, pilot-first approach. Integration Complexity with existing, often siloed systems (SIS, LMS, CRM) requires careful planning to avoid creating new data headaches. Cultural Adoption is critical; faculty and staff skepticism must be overcome through clear communication about AI as a support tool, not a replacement for human judgment. Finally, Data Governance and Ethics are paramount. Ensuring algorithmic fairness in admissions or grading support and rigorously protecting student privacy (FERPA) requires robust policies and oversight that may strain smaller administrative teams. Success depends on selecting vendors with strong compliance frameworks and building internal cross-functional oversight committees.

Why would a liberal arts university invest in AI?
AI augments, not replaces, the humanistic core. It frees faculty from administrative tasks for more student interaction and provides data-driven insights to support the whole student, aligning with the university's mission of personalized education.
What are the biggest risks in deploying AI here?
Key risks include protecting sensitive student data (FERPA), ensuring algorithmic fairness in admissions/advising, managing faculty skepticism, and integrating with legacy IT systems without major disruption.
How can a university of this size start with AI?
Start with focused pilots: an AI writing tutor in the writing center or predictive analytics for a specific at-risk cohort. Use SaaS platforms to avoid heavy internal dev. Secure buy-in from key faculty champions.
